1

Car accessories abu dhabi Things To Know Before You Buy

News Discuss 
Whether or not you’re in need of high quality pet food, grooming companies, or specialist guidance, the best pet shops in Dubai are devoted to catering to all your pet care needs. Pick out good quality, pick out excellence, and give your pets the love and a focus they are https://miriamz234ecy0.eveowi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story